The City of Chicago Cultural Center: A Hub of Artistic Splendor
Nestled in the heart of downtown Chicago, the City of Chicago Cultural Center stands as a beacon of cultural richness and artistic expression. Housed in a majestic historic building with stunning architecture, this iconic landmark serves as a vibrant hub for creativity and community engagement.
Originally constructed in 1897 as the city’s first central library, the Cultural Center was transformed into a cultural institution in 1991. Since then, it has been a focal point for showcasing a diverse range of artistic disciplines, from visual arts and music to literature and performance.
One of the standout features of the Cultural Center is its breathtaking Tiffany Dome, a masterpiece of stained glass artistry that crowns the Preston Bradley Hall. Visitors are awe-struck by the intricate details and vibrant colors that illuminate the space, creating an atmosphere of wonder and inspiration.
The center hosts a dynamic array of exhibitions, concerts, lectures, and workshops throughout the year, attracting both local residents and tourists alike. From showcasing emerging artists to celebrating established luminaries, the Cultural Center offers something for every art enthusiast.
In addition to its role as an exhibition space, the Cultural Center is also committed to fostering community engagement through educational programs and outreach initiatives. It serves as a gathering place where people from all walks of life can come together to celebrate creativity and diversity.

1. What are the opening hours of the City of Chicago Cultural Center?
The City of Chicago Cultural Center welcomes visitors during the following opening hours: Monday through Thursday from 10:00 AM to 7:00 PM, and Friday through Sunday from 10:00 AM to 5:00 PM. Please note that these hours are subject to change for holidays or special events, so we recommend checking the official website or contacting the Cultural Center directly for the most up-to-date information on visiting hours.
2. Is admission to the Cultural Center free?
Yes, admission to the City of Chicago Cultural Center is completely free for all visitors. Whether you’re a local resident or a tourist exploring the city, you can enjoy the diverse range of exhibitions, performances, and events at the Cultural Center without any cost. This commitment to accessibility ensures that everyone has the opportunity to experience and appreciate the cultural richness that the center has to offer. 3. Are there guided tours available at the Cultural Center?
Yes, guided tours are available at the City of Chicago Cultural Center for visitors who wish to delve deeper into the rich history and artistic offerings of this iconic institution. Led by knowledgeable docents, these tours provide insights into the architectural significance of the building, highlight key artistic installations, and offer a behind-the-scenes look at the various exhibitions and events hosted at the Cultural Center. 7. How do I get to the City of Chicago Cultural Center using public transportation?
To reach the City of Chicago Cultural Center using public transportation, you have several convenient options available. The Cultural Center is easily accessible via the Chicago Transit Authority (CTA) train and bus services. If you prefer taking the train, you can use the ‘L’ train system and get off at either the Washington/Wabash or Monroe stops, both of which are a short walk from the Cultural Center. Alternatively, numerous bus routes operate near the center, including stops along Michigan Avenue and Washington Street.
